Perplexity vs ChatGPT: Which AI Needs Which Prompts?

Perplexity and ChatGPT solve fundamentally different problems. Perplexity is a citation-first AI search engine built for research. ChatGPT is a versatile AI assistant built for creation and conversation. This guide shows you how to prompt each one for maximum results.

Perplexity and ChatGPT are both $20/month AI subscriptions, but they're built for different jobs. Perplexity is an AI-powered search engine that cites every claim with sources. ChatGPT is a general-purpose AI assistant with a massive ecosystem of custom GPTs, plugins, and multimodal capabilities.

Most power users end up using both — Perplexity for research, ChatGPT for creation. But prompting them the same way wastes their strengths. This guide shows exactly how to adjust your prompts for each platform.

When to Use Perplexity

Fact-checking and source verification

Every Perplexity response includes inline citations with clickable sources. For research that requires verifiable claims, this is far more reliable than ChatGPT's uncited responses.

Real-time information retrieval

Perplexity searches the web on every query by default. No toggle, no special mode — current data is built into every response.

Multi-source research synthesis

Perplexity Pro Search performs multiple web searches per query, synthesizing information across sources into a single cited answer. Ideal for competitive analysis, market research, and literature reviews.

Quick factual answers

For "what is X" or "how does Y work" questions, Perplexity delivers concise, sourced answers faster than ChatGPT — with proof.

When to Use ChatGPT

Creative content generation

ChatGPT is dramatically better at writing blog posts, marketing copy, scripts, and creative content. Perplexity is optimized for factual retrieval, not creative generation.

Code generation and debugging

ChatGPT's code generation, debugging, and development tool integrations are far more mature than Perplexity's limited coding capabilities.

Custom AI assistants

ChatGPT's custom GPTs let you build persistent, specialized assistants with custom instructions, memory, and tool access — a capability Perplexity doesn't offer.

Iterative multi-turn workflows

ChatGPT's conversational strength makes it ideal for "draft → refine → polish" workflows. Perplexity is better for single-query research than extended back-and-forth.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Perplexity better than ChatGPT for research?
Yes. Perplexity cites every claim with sources by default — ChatGPT does not. Perplexity searches the web on every query automatically. For factual research requiring verifiable sources, Perplexity is the stronger tool.
Is ChatGPT better than Perplexity for writing?
Yes. ChatGPT produces more creative, polished writing across all formats — blog posts, marketing copy, scripts, and fiction. Perplexity is optimized for factual synthesis, not creative content generation.
Can Perplexity replace ChatGPT?
Not for most users. Perplexity excels at search and research but lacks ChatGPT's creative writing, code generation, custom GPTs, plugin ecosystem, and multimodal capabilities. Most power users subscribe to both.
Do Perplexity and ChatGPT use the same AI models?
Perplexity Pro gives access to multiple models including GPT-4 and Claude through its interface, but its core Sonar models are proprietary. ChatGPT runs exclusively on OpenAI's GPT models. The same underlying model can produce different results due to each platform's different search and prompting infrastructure.
Which is more accurate, Perplexity or ChatGPT?
For factual accuracy, Perplexity leads. Its Sonar Pro scored an F-score of 0.858 on SimpleQA, the leading factuality benchmark. Perplexity's real-time web search means it doesn't rely on training data for current facts.
Are Perplexity and ChatGPT the same price?
Both offer free tiers and $20/month Pro plans. Perplexity also has a $200/month Max tier with agent capabilities. ChatGPT has a $200/month Pro tier. Enterprise pricing differs: Perplexity Enterprise Pro starts at $40/seat, ChatGPT Team is $25/seat.
